Optimisation à 2 variables

Fermé
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 - 17 oct. 2012 à 18:40
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 - 20 oct. 2012 à 18:54
Bonjour,

Je voudrais savoir s'il existe une manière de faire en sorte que Excel fasse une optimisation du problème que je lui propose.

Je m'explique, mon but est d'avoir le meilleur rapport distance/consommation (Mille/Gallon). Il y a deux facteurs qui pourront variés dans cette expérience, soit l'Altitude et le RPM, ces 2 variables ne peuvent prendre que certaines valeur :
altitude : 2000;4000;6000;8000;10000
RPM : 2200;2300;2400;2500;2550;2600

il sont sous une liste déroulante chacune dans leur cellule respective

quand je fais varié une de ces 2 variables la cellule en D5 calcule automatiquement le nombre de mille/gallon, donc je suppose qu'il faut que cette fameuse fonction prenne en mémoire temporaire les réponses de D5 en faisant varié mes 2 variables en E2 et F2

voici une image pour vous représentez: https://www.cjoint.com/?BJrsFj2KFMD

Merci à l'avance de votre aide

A voir également:

5 réponses

Le Pingou Messages postés 12035 Date d'inscription mercredi 11 août 2004 Statut Contributeur Dernière intervention 1 avril 2024 1 425
17 oct. 2012 à 21:19
Bonjour,
L'utilisation du solveur devrait faire l'affaire, reste à savoir la formule utilisée en D5 ?
0
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 4
18 oct. 2012 à 00:16
en fait il y a beaucoup de formule utilisé, D5 n'est qu'une redirection vers ma feuille CALCUL en B5, qui elle est la division de la vitesse sol(VS) sur la consommation (GPH)

(GPH) en B2 est une grosse formule de SI utiliser de sorte pour faire une genre de rechercheV / index qui recherche selon 3 variables

(VS) est le résultat de la suite d'une dizaine de formule dans des cellules différente


après installation du solveur ça me semble positif à l'exception que le solveur utilise tout les nombre dans les variable au lieu d'utiliser ma liste(ps: j'ai coché l'option arrêt dans les alertes erreurs de la mise en forme pour l'obliger à ne pas prendre des nombre du genre 2000.002 ). le pire c'est que même quand je met des contrainte dans le solveur : entier seulement pour mes variables il utilise quand même des chiffre à virgule


comment faire en sorte que le solveur ne trouve que les solutions avec les possibilité que je lui donne, car s'il utilise une valeur autre que dans la liste ma consommation affiche N/A car il ne peut pas la calculer
0
Raymond PENTIER Messages postés 58389 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 18 avril 2024 17 090
18 oct. 2012 à 00:24
Bonjour kbastien.

Remarque générale : Pour nous aider dans la compréhension d'un problème Excel, et dans la rédaction de sa solution, ce n'est une image (capture d'écran) qu'il nous faut, mais le fichier lu-même.

Pour la question posée, il serait très utile que tu nous adresses un lien vers le fichier, l'image proposée ne nous donnant qu'une idée sur la présentation du tableau, et absolument pas sur les calculs opérés.

Cordialement.
0
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 4
18 oct. 2012 à 00:55
je viens de le rajouté dans ma question
0
Raymond PENTIER Messages postés 58389 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 18 avril 2024 17 090
18 oct. 2012 à 05:35
Bien ! Malheureusement, tes calculs sont bien trop compliqués pour moi, et je ne vois pas quel genre d'optimisation on pourrait envisager.
Bon courage pour la suite ...
0
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 4
Modifié par kbastien le 18/10/2012 à 00:56
https://www.cjoint.com/?0Jsa4nTdRDS voici le fichier excel
0
Le Pingou Messages postés 12035 Date d'inscription mercredi 11 août 2004 Statut Contributeur Dernière intervention 1 avril 2024 1 425
18 oct. 2012 à 08:46
Bonjour,
Merci pour l'information.
Pour comprendre le tout il serait bien d'avoir le fichier avec la solution « Solveur » !
Au passage, salutations à Raymond.
0
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 4
20 oct. 2012 à 18:54
Voilà j'ai rajouter le fichier avec le scénario

PS: je sais que j'ai mis comme contrainte des entier seulement pour les variable, mais en fait il faudrait être encore plus précis que ça et mettre comme contrainte :prendre seulement les données dans la liste déroulante, malheureusement je ne sais pas comment faire, si quelqu'un a une idée...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
kbastien Messages postés 64 Date d'inscription dimanche 26 décembre 2010 Statut Membre Dernière intervention 1 avril 2020 4
20 oct. 2012 à 18:51
https://www.cjoint.com/?0JusYk25Eu5 fichier avec le sénario du solveur
0